Froth Flotation Of Copper - floweryourmoment

Froth Flotation Of Copper. The copper minerals and waste rock are separated at the mill using froth flotation. The copper ore slurry from the grinding mills is mixed with milk of lime simply water and ground-up limestone to give a basic pH, pine oil yes, it comes from trees -- a by-product of paper mills to make bubbles, an alcohol to strengthen the bubbles, and a collector chemical

Froth flotation - Wikipedia

Froth flotation is a process for selectively separating of hydrophobic materials from hydrophilic.This is used in mineral processing, paper recycling and waste-water treatment industries. Historically this was first used in the mining industry, where it was one of the great enabling technologies of the 20th century.

A cascaded recognition method for copper rougher flotation,

16-01-2018· Fig. 1 shows the rougher flotation in a certain copper flotation site. During the whole flotation process, rougher is the first step of screening after ore is ground, mixed with water and classified. The products from rougher include the rougher froth on top of the cell and the pulp flow at the bottom of the cell.

Separating Minerals by Floatation - ABB

Separating Minerals by Floatation Copper processing example A high pH is important in the processing of copper ore to maximize this mineral‘s floatation properties. Most copper ore slurries tend to be acidic. Plants typically add lime to the slurry in the mill or floatation circuit, increasing its alkalinity.

Flotation Froth - an overview | ScienceDirect Topics

Froth flotation is a process that selectively separates materials based upon whether they are water repelling (hydrophobic) or have an affinity for water (hydrophilic). Importantly, the word flotation is also used in the literature to describe the process in density separation in which lighter microplastics float to the surface of a salt solution.
